#6ccd01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ccd01 is composed of 42.4% red, 80.4%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 88.5 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 40.4%. #6ccd01 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ff02 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#6ccd01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a00 is the darkest color, while #fafff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ccd01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676e60 is the less saturated color, while #6ccd01 is the most saturated one.
